For startups targeting Southeast Asia or global business, Singapore cloud server VPS is one of the top choices for deployment. Its geographical advantages, low latency, and stable international links make Singapore a key node connecting China, Southeast Asia, Europe, and the United States.
In terms of cost, the starting price for a basic VPS is usually between $10 and $30 per month (about 70 to 210 RMB). These configurations typically offer a 1-core CPU, 1GB-2GB memory, 20GB SSD, and 1TB of data, making them suitable for lightweight applications and testing environments.
For projects withproduction environments or expected traffic growth, it is recommended to choose configurations with 2 cores or more, 4GB-8GB memory, 50GB-200GB SSDs, and on-demand or monthly bandwidth. The price generally ranges from $30 to $100 per month, depending on bandwidth and the number of public IPs.
Bandwidth and public IP are crucial: When your business mainly relies on websites, APIs, or mini-programs, it is recommended to configure at least 100Mbps shared bandwidth or over 10TB of traffic packets, while reserving one or more independent public IPs for SSL certificate and reverse proxy configuration.
For disks, it is recommended to prioritize SSDs and support snapshot and backup functions. Snapshots can quickly roll back during deployment, upgrades, or failures, reducing the risk of outages. For I/O-intensive services like databases, high-IOPS disks or dedicated cloud drives are preferred.
For systems and operations, choosing vendors with rich images that support mainstream Linux/Windows systems and market mirrors can save deployment costs. It is recommended to combine automated operations and maintenance tools, monitoring alarms, and scheduled backups to maintain business stability.

Domain name resolution and certificate management should not be overlooked. Configure domain resolution on stable DNS services, enable DNS resolution acceleration and TTL optimization, and combine with free or paid SSL certificates to enhance access security and trust.
CDNs can significantly reduce latency, ease source site pressure, and improve page loading speed. Startups can start by using pay-as-you-go CDNs to scale nodes on demand, and when necessary, enable caching strategies and page acceleration rules to optimize costs.
For security protection, it is recommended to configure both high-protection DDoS and WAF simultaneously. The high-protection solutions commonly found at Singapore nodes offer DDoS purification billed by peak traffic, ensuring business remains available during attacks. Exposed APIs and management ports should be combined with access control and two-factor authentication.
Purchase advice: Start with a trial or a small monthly payment plan to verify network and latency; Once the business stabilizes, pay annually or upgrade to higher configurations to get discounts. Cost-sensitive startups can prioritize purchasing a basic VPS and combine it with CDN and cloud backup to control overhead.
When choosing a vendor, compare network quality, after-sales support, control panel usability, and value-added services (such as snapshots, load balancing, proprietary bandwidth, and high protection). If migration or expansion is needed, prioritize solutions that provide traffic packages and flexible bandwidth adjustments.
